-som
Danish
Etymology
From Old Norse -samr. Related to samme (“same”). Compare Albanian -shëm, -sham.
Pronunciation
Suffix
-som
- -some (characterized by some specific condition or quality)
Usage notes
Forms adjectives, inflected: neuter -somt, definite and plural -somme, comparative -sommere, superlative -somst.

Old Irish
Alternative forms
- -sem (used in later texts after palatalized consonants and front vowels)
Pronunciation
Suffix
-som
- emphatic suffix of the following persons; used after velarized consonants and back vowels
- third-person singular masculine
- third-person singular neuter
- third-person plural all genders
